Impressive 79 m² apartment set within an exclusive private gated community in the prestigious Princesa Kristina area (Manilva). The complex offers a secure and tranquil environment with well-maintained gardens and two communal swimming pools (one for adults and one for children). Being a third-floor unit, the property benefits from superior natural light, enhanced privacy, and the finest panoramic views in the area. Layout and Outdoor Spaces: • Main Terrace: An oversized outdoor living area fitted with high-end Lumon glass curtains, accessible from both the living room and the master bedroom—perfect for a seamless indoor-outdoor lifestyle all year round. • Second Terrace: A private retreat with direct access from the second bedroom, ideal as an independent relaxation area. • Interior: Independent kitchen featuring a large adjoining utility room (for laundry, dryer, and storage), 2 double bedrooms with fitted wardrobes, and 2 full bathrooms (master ensuite). Key Features: • Quality Finishes: Premium Lumon glass system, marble floors, hot & cold air conditioning, and electric blinds. • Included Extras: The price includes a private parking space and a convenient storage room within the secure complex. • Location: A strategic setting that balances the exclusivity of a private complex with proximity to local schools, transport links, and amenities. Buying property in Spain
Spain welcomes foreign buyers with no nationality restrictions. The buyer needs an NIE (Número de Identidad de Extranjero) before completion, and most buyers open a Spanish bank account to handle the deposit and ongoing charges. An independent lawyer (abogado) is strongly recommended — the notario only checks the deed, not the wider title.
Spain ended its Golden Visa property route in April 2025.
Non-resident mortgages are widely available, typically 60–70% LTV.
Non-resident sellers face a 3% withholding from the sale price (retención), claimable against capital gains tax.
Always check community-of-owners (comunidad) debts and outstanding IBI before completion — they transfer with the property.
General guidance only — confirm specifics with a qualified local lawyer or tax adviser. Reference
